Yancey and I talked this morning about all the great new records on the site today and I even mentioned to him not to overlook the new Picastro. So what does he go and do in his massive, epic, awesome new arrivals post? He forgets the new Picastro.
Can’t blame him, really. Who wants to type out the words Whore Luck, anyway? But with guests like Owen Pallett of Final Fantasy adding various instrumental work throughout and Jamie Stewart of Xiu Xiu singing backup on a seasick cover of the Fall’s “An Older Lover Etc,” it’s hard not to want to scream it from the rooftops: what about the new Picastro!?!
I kid. A bit. Whore Luck isn’t some sort of masterpiece, but there are masterful moments that I’d highly recommend checking out. The aforementioned cover first and foremost (called “Older Lover” here), but also the downcast down home opener, “Hortur.” (The latter sounds like what might happen if Godspeed You Black Emperor were forced at gunpoint to write a country song.) Oh. And the other stunning cover here, Roky Erickson’s “If You Have Ghosts.” The rest, honestly, I can mostly take or leave, but these three songs each come at important points in the record (beginning, middle, end), holding this fragile little thing together.
